An Israeli Arab town reportedly will receive millions of dollars from Qatar for its soccer facilities. Ha’aretz reported Wednesday that the Gulf emirate wants to help Sakhnin, whose soccer team has swept national tournaments, land “firmly on the Middle East sports map.”
